Job Overview

This position is responsible for the development, implementation, management, and administration of clinical trial protocols.

Interfaces with federal and corporate sponsors, inpatient and outpatient facilities, departments, and personnel to assure a collaborative environment and high-quality outcomes.

Coordinates and delivers patient care.

Duties and Responsibilities : The duties and responsibilities listed below are intended to describe the general nature of work and are not intended to be an all-inclusive list.

Other duties and responsibilities may be assigned.

1. Reviews proposed protocols with the Principal Investigators to assess the feasibility of undertaking the project.

2. Assists in preparation of initiating documentation, budget preparation, and resource and personnel allocation, and consent form creation.

3. Works as a liaison with IRB to facilitate approval of projects and ongoing documentation and reporting.

4. Liaisons with sponsor agency and monitoring personnel.

5. Interacts with PI and collaborating physicians, inpatient and outpatient facilities, and personnel to comply with study protocols and requirements.

6. Coordinates and manages patient recruitment, monitoring, and documentation of care and progress.

7. Provides direct patient care including interviewing to obtain relevant historical, medical personal, and physical data for patient data collection forms.

8. Collects specimens and prepares, handles, stores, and mails as necessary for various protocols.

9. Records test results accurately and timely, inpatient hospital records, case report forms, and MD's own record (clinic charts).

10. Provides patient information, instruction in written and verbal form in patient diary, keeping medication usage and protocol compliance.

11. Maintains collaborative, team relationships with peers and colleagues in order to effectively contribute to the working group's achievement of goals, and to help foster a positive work environment.
